Previously, the shared buffer pools were allocated on the
nvmf controllers. When a new connection was established,
the CONNECT command needs a 4k buffer, but we didn't know
which nvmf controller it belonged to until after the
CONNECT command completed. So there was a special case
for CONNECT that used in capsule data buffers instead.
Now, the buffer pool is global and always available. We
can just use that always, with no more special cases.
This has the additional nice side effect of allowing
users to run the target with no in capsule data buffers
allocated at all.

The RDMA protocol this module uses is strictly ordered,
which means messages are delivered in exactly the order
they are sent. However, we have detected a number of
cases where the acknowledgements for those messages
arrive out of order. This patch attempts to handle
that case.
Separate the data required to post a recv from the
data required to send a response. If a recv arrives
when no response object is available, queue the
recv.

The generic NVMe library controller initialization process already
handles enabling the controller; the RDMA transport should not need to
set EN itself.
For now, the discovery controller is cheating and not using the normal
initialization process, so move the EN = 1 hack to the discovery
controller bringup until it is overhauled to use the full
nvme_ctrlr_process_init() path.
The previous code where CC.EN was set to 1 before going through the
controller init process would cause an EN = 1 to EN = 0 transition,
which triggers a controller level reset.
This change stops us from causing a reset during the controller
startup sequence, which is defined by the NVMe over Fabrics spec as
terminating the host/controller association (breaking the connection).
Our NVMe over Fabrics target does not yet implement this correctly, but
we should still do the right thing in preparation for a full reset
implementation.
This patch also reverts the NVMe over Fabrics target reset
handling hack that was added as part of the NVMe over Fabrics host
commit to its previous state of just printing an error message.

For iWARP devices, buffers that are intended to be the
target of an RDMA read initiated by the target must additionally
have IBV_ACCESS_REMOTE_WRITE permission. This is because iWARP's
RDMA read path essentially requests the remote side to do
an RDMA write.
This is unfortunate because there is no way to differentiate between
memory that the remote side can do an RDMA write to and memory
that will only be the target of RDMA reads initiated by the
target. There is nothing we can do about this serious deficiency in
the specification, however, so we have to live with it.

The Dataset Management command allows several operations to be specified
at once; the virtual controller only supports deallocate for now, but it
should just ignore the other bits in order to be spec compliant: "If the
Dataset Management command is supported, all combinations of attributes
[...] may be set".
The spec also explicitly states that it is acceptable for controllers to
choose to take no action based on information provided, so not
implementing the other attributes is fine.
